Pacemaster Gold Treadmill Review

Think about a solid machine, with an expanded running area, complete digital control, various workouts and detailed workouts feedback. You have described the PaceMaster Gold Treadmill.

This is a solid machine that comes with a 3 HP Continuous Duty McMillan motor. Its power is strong enough to sustain walking and running exercises for a long period of time.

Another advantage of this machine is the belt (rated at 10,000 miles!) which ensures comfort for any height and weight (within 400 lbs limit).The easy to use console includes various workouts and covers different training areas, such as: heart rate programs, custom workouts, workouts with different levels of intensity.

Let’s not forget the warranty (lifetime for frame, 12 years for motor, 5 years for parts and 1 year for labor). Based on these features and many other details listed below you could not get more for the same price (around $2300!).

Pacemaster Gold Specifications

1. Speed: 12 mph
The Gold unit reaches a top speed of 12 mph, a value that satisfies even heavy runners.

2. Inclination: 0-15%
The PaceMaster Gold Treadmill reaches a maximum incline value of 15%. The elevation is set via 2 Express incline keys with 0.5% increments.

3. Motor
This unit comes with a powerful 3 CHP heavy duty motor produced by McMillan. Also the elevation motor can provide 1000lb thrust.

4. Belt: 20″ x 60″
This PaceMaster model features a large walking area (20″ x 60″) that comes with a stretch resistant 2 ply texglide belt (rated for 10,000 miles). This machine comes also with the Tri-Flex impact shock management system attached to the belt.

5. Warranty
PaceMaster offer for this model a lifetime warranty for frame, 12 years for the motor, 5 years for the parts and one year for labor.

Pacemaster Gold Special Features

Virtual Reality Courses
The Gold Elite VR Treadmill comes with a unique feature: The Virtual Reality courses. With this PaceMaster version you get distance based VR workouts in the comfort of your home. The four VR Course included are: Lombard Street, Steeple Chase, Appalachian Trail and Summit Climb.

Tri-Flex Impact Shock Management
This is one of the best cushioning systems on the market and it’s composed of 3 main pieces: custom engineered tread deck, custom elastomer cushion and aluminum frame. This system ensures a superior joint protection and improved comfort.

The PaceMaster Gold Treadmill can support a top user weight of 400 lbs.

The following features & functions are also included: Welded aircraft grade frame, Dual Microprocessor Digital Control System for motor control, 2.5″ precision rollers and Automatic Warm-Up/Cool-Down, Virtual Reality Courses, 12 X 15 Multi-Color Dot Matrix and Automatic Warm-Up/Cool-Down.

Conclusions

With this machine the PaceMaster continues the success line started with the PaceMaster Bronze.

After completing our review we confirm this treadmill version is definitely a very good machine. There are two versions you can choose from: PaceMaster Gold Elite VR and Gold Elite Fold-up VR.

During our tests we chose only the non folding version (it’s a little less expensive) but this has the same engine and electronics as the fold up unit.Overall we cannot say anything bad about this machine. The only problem may appear if you don’t have the money to buy it: it costs around $2299.

The running area is generous and can satisfy even those with long strides. The cushioning system really improves the comfort of the runner. All these parts are powered by a powerful 3.0 CHP McMillan motor.

We were very impressed by the fact that it does not produce much noise. In fact we think this is the quietest treadmill we’ve tested so far. You can watch TV and run at the same time without any discomfort.

The console has a minimalist but at the same time, very interesting design. There are plenty of preset workouts and electronic features to choose from.

The warranty is very good. You don’t get a lifetime warranty for motor (trust us is just a marketing thing). Instead you get lifetime for frame, 5 year for parts and 12 year for motor. This is more than enough.

We did some research on the Net before writing our review and we read several negative reviews for this machine. From what we’ve read, all of these negative reviews were caused by broken parts or units but none by bad performances. All the reviews we found had been written several years ago so we can conclude that at this point all these issues have already been corrected by the manufacturer.

As a conclusion for the PaceMaster Gold treadmill review: this is a very good treadmill! The only problem you may have is the high price. If you can get it for around 2000 don’t hesitate to buy it. This is an excellent deal!
